Colts officials indicated Friday that Joseph Addai's "bruised shoulder" is similar to an injury he dealt with last season.

Addai played in every game as a rookie, including all four playoff wins. "He got hit on that shoulder and got that bruise," coach Tony Dungy said. "It’s really more in the chest now. (Addai) says it's better than what it was in the playoffs. But obviously the playoffs was a do-or-die situation." Addai remains a game-time decision for Week 5. Be prepared with other options.

Source: Indiana News

The Indianapolis Star reports the Colts will likely err on the side of caution this week regarding "questionable" players Marvin Harrison (knee strain), Bob Sanders (ribs), and Joseph Addai (shoulder/chest).

The 4-0 Colts may be looking at their upcoming bye in Week 6 as a means to get their best players healthy. "If they feel good mentally, (they) will go," coach Tony Dungy said after practice Friday. "But the other guys have practiced all week and if there's any doubt, we'll go with the guys who have practiced."

Source: Indianapolis Star

ESPN's John Clayton reported on Sportscenter Saturday that Joseph Addai, Marvin Harrison, Bob Sanders, and Freddie Keiaho are unlikely to play Sunday.

This goes along with what the local papers are saying in Indianapolis. Fantasy owners should assume they will be without Addai. The only way you can wait is if you own Kenton Keith or another option from the late games that could replace him in lineups.

 
On Press Coverage (Sirius) this morning they had Colts beat writer Tom James on who reported Addai is out for Sunday.
